The Ulster Youth Orchestra meets regularly every summer for two weeks of intensive training followed by concerts. This additional event, which merged the two orchestras, gave the young players a valuable chance to perform with professionals. Together, they certainly produced a big sound, and in an enjoyable one-off extravaganza like this one won't quibble if they also sometimes produced thick textures.

Stephen Barlow, the artistic director of Opera Northern Ireland, obtained clean-cut, well-balanced performances from his potentially unwieldy forces. Mars, the first of The Planets, acquired an ominous truculence at his steady pace. Understandably, the rousing Jupiter and Uranus came off better than the subtler Venus and Mercury. Neptune, the Mystic remained unmystical, but featured steady singing from the girl choristers of Victoria College.
